WebIn Georgia law, it designates certain professionals as mandated reporters of child abuse or neglect [OCGA 19-7-5 (c) (1)]. If you are one of the following people and have … WebContact DFCS Child Protective Services. Child abuse and/or neglect reports are taken 24 hours a day, seven days a week. Primary: 1.855.GACHILD ( +1 855-422-4453 ) Contact …

WebIf you are one of the following people and have reasonable cause to believe that a child has been abused, you must make a report, immediately but no later than 24 hours, to your local DFCS office or law enforcement and are subject to criminal penalty for failing to do so.
